Ahmad Azhar represents the modern global in-house legal leader who seamlessly combines litigation expertise, corporate governance, cross-border compliance, technology law, and commercial strategy to help organizations manage legal risks in an increasingly interconnected world. As Lead Counsel at HCL Technologies, he brings over sixteen years of experience spanning litigation, government representation, dispute resolution, employment law, commercial contracts, regulatory compliance, and global legal operations. His philosophy reflects a powerful belief—that the role of an in-house lawyer is not merely to resolve disputes, but to anticipate risks, enable business growth, and create legal frameworks that prevent future challenges.

In this episode of The Koffee Conversation Show – The Emerging Lawyer Series, themed “Navigating Global Compliance & Corporate Complexity with Ahmad Azhar,” Ahmad shares valuable insights on litigation, global compliance, technology contracts, cross-border negotiations, SaaS, AI, leadership, risk management, and building an international legal career. His perspective highlights a critical truth—the modern legal professional must think beyond statutes and contracts to understand technology, business strategy, governance, and global commercial realities.

Interestingly, Ahmad’s journey began as a first-generation lawyer who entered litigation more out of circumstance than design. Starting in courtrooms and eventually representing matters before the Supreme Court of India, government bodies, and arbitral forums, he developed a deep appreciation for legal strategy under pressure. Over time, he transformed those courtroom experiences into valuable insights that now help businesses proactively manage legal risks in global boardrooms.

A defining aspect of Ahmad’s career has been his ability to bridge courtroom advocacy with corporate leadership. Whether negotiating international technology contracts, advising leadership teams on regulatory compliance, handling employment disputes, or navigating complex global commercial arrangements, he consistently focuses on balancing legal protection with business practicality. His journey demonstrates that successful legal leaders combine technical expertise with foresight, adaptability, commercial awareness, and a global mindset.
